Securing MBBS admission in India without paying any donation is possible through proper planning and merit-based strategies. Here's how:
Crack NEET with a High Score: Admission to MBBS programs in India is strictly based on NEET-UG scores. A higher score increases your chances of getting a government or reputed private college seat without any donation.
Apply to Government Medical Colleges: These colleges offer the most affordable medical education and do not accept any donation. Seat allotment is purely merit-based.
Use All India & State Quota Counseling: Participate in both AIQ (15%) and your respective State Quota (85%) counseling rounds to maximize your chances of selection.
Consider AIIMS & JIPMER: These premier institutions offer top-quality education without any donation or capitation fee, solely based on NEET ranks.
Look for Scholarships and Reserved Quotas: Utilize scholarships, EWS, SC/ST/OBC reservations, or economically weaker section quotas if eligible.
Explore Private Colleges with Merit-Based Seats: Some private and deemed universities offer seats based on NEET scores without any hidden donations.
✅ Pro Tip: Avoid agents promising guaranteed seats with or without donation. Always go through official channels like MCC and state DME portals.
